President Donald Trump criticized former Vice President Joe Biden on Tuesday for failing to enforce a national mask mandate — but Biden, as a candidate, has no authority to do so.
When asked by a voter during an ABC News town hall why he has not supported universal mask-wearing, Trump diverted to blame his 2020 Democratic opponent for having not done so.
"A good question is you ask, like Joe Biden, they said 'we're going to do a national mandate on masks,'" Trump said Tuesday evening. "But he didn't do it, I mean, he never did it."
"They said at the Democratic Convention they're going to do a national mandate, they never did it because they checked out and they didn't do it," he said.
